Control Cabinet Protection Strategy

The 330103-00-14-10-02-05 proximity probe does not operate in isolation — it is the sensing front-end of a tightly integrated machinery protection architecture. In a properly configured control cabinet, this probe pairs with the Bently Nevada 3300 XL Proximitor Sensor (such as the 330180-X1-05 series) to condition the raw eddy-current signal into a calibrated DC voltage output suitable for the monitor rack. The monitor rack — typically a Bently Nevada 3500 Series Machinery Protection System — receives this signal and executes trip logic, alarm thresholds, and interlock commands in real time.

Within the same protection loop, power supply stability is critical. Fluctuations in the –24 VDC supply rail feeding the proximitor can introduce signal offset errors that mimic actual shaft displacement events, triggering nuisance trips or — more dangerously — masking genuine fault conditions. A dedicated Bently Nevada 3500/15 Power Supply Module or equivalent redundant DC power conditioner should be installed to isolate the measurement chain from upstream power quality disturbances, including voltage sags, switching transients, and ground loops common in heavy industrial switchgear environments.

For facilities operating in high-EMI zones — adjacent to large variable frequency drives (VFDs), arc furnaces, or high-current bus bars — additional signal integrity is achieved by routing the probe cable through dedicated metallic conduit, maintaining physical separation from power cabling, and ensuring single-point grounding at the monitor chassis. In such environments, the Bently Nevada 330130 Extension Cable with its double-shielded coaxial construction provides the necessary noise immunity to preserve measurement accuracy across long cable runs between the machine and the remote monitor rack.

Where safety integrity level (SIL) requirements apply — such as in SIL 2 or SIL 3 certified overspeed protection or high-vibration trip systems — the 330103-00-14-10-02-05 is validated for use within Bently Nevada TDIXl and compatible safety-rated monitor configurations. Complementary components such as the Bently Nevada 3500/42M Proximitor/Seismic Monitor complete the safety loop, providing voted trip outputs, self-diagnostics, and channel-to-channel comparison to detect sensor degradation before it compromises the protection function.

Critical Industrial Safety Applications

In petrochemical and refinery operations, the 330103-00-14-10-02-05 is deployed on critical rotating assets including centrifugal compressors, reactor charge pumps, and crude distillation column overhead compressors. These machines operate continuously under API 670 protection mandates, where shaft radial vibration and axial position must be monitored without interruption. A probe failure or signal dropout in this context can trigger an unplanned unit shutdown, with restart costs measured in hundreds of thousands of dollars per hour of lost production.

In thermal and combined-cycle power generation, this probe series monitors steam turbine shaft eccentricity, differential expansion, and journal bearing vibration. The ability to maintain accurate measurement through thermal cycling — from cold startup through full-load operation at elevated ambient temperatures — is a defining reliability requirement that the 3300 XL series is specifically engineered to meet.

In mining and mineral processing environments, where crusher drives, ball mill pinion shafts, and slurry pump motors operate in dust-laden, high-humidity, and high-vibration conditions, the sealed construction and robust cable armor of the 330103-00-14-10-02-05 provide the ingress protection and mechanical durability required for long-term field deployment without frequent recalibration or replacement.

In water and wastewater treatment facilities, large vertical turbine pumps and blower trains rely on proximity-based vibration monitoring to detect bearing wear, rotor imbalance, and misalignment before catastrophic failure. The 330103-00-14-10-02-05 supports continuous condition monitoring in these applications, enabling predictive maintenance strategies that extend mean time between failures (MTBF) and reduce unplanned outage risk.

In metallurgical and steel production plants, where rolling mill drives, converter vessel tilt drives, and continuous caster pinch rolls operate under extreme thermal and mechanical stress, the probe’s high-temperature rating and vibration tolerance make it a reliable choice for both protection and condition monitoring roles in safety-critical drive trains.
